Until lately I was able to defragment on a weekly basis. Yesterday I tried and first got the message when I was 68% complete that I would have to scandisk. I did successfully, defragmented again, and at 14% was told to scandisk again. It became a vicious cycle. Any help would be appreciated.

do a full surface scan, you might have damage sectors in your hardrive, and it might becoming damage, if it finds damage clusters (BAD CLUSTERS) then that is why it is doing it. until it mark it as BAD. it will let you continue.
Check if you have any active software automatic run on background. The most popular ones is FindFast and Screensaver. Make sure that you stop FindFast (by control panel) and disable your screensaver.

The problem that caused this is usually a program that is always running like an anti-virus program, Microsoft Office "Find Fast" or Norton Utilities. Try looking through the programs that you terminated to run scandisk until you come up with the one that interferes and then just end that one and you should be fine.
